Penn Credit Corporation at phone number - has called me 44 times from the period -/-/- thru today 's date of -/-/-. I only started tracking the calls on - - when I realized there was a problem. When I answer the calls, a machine states " if you are this person, press 1 ; if you are not this person, press 2 ''. Nothing else. They do n't even mention the name of the person. I have not pressed either 1 or 2 as I am afraid it may be a spammer. I have researched this company and it is apparent there are many consumers and individuals also dealing with this company and harassing, repeated calls. I have no known outstanding debt, a great credit score, and have received no notices via mail or overnight delivery regarding outstanding bills from Penn Credit or any other company for that matter. On some days, I receive calls from Penn Credit Corp. two or three times. No messages are left. I am being harassed by this company and I want it to stop. Immediately.
